Program Summary
Statistics is a course that focuses on the collection, analysis, interpretation, presentation, and organization of data. It teaches students how to use mathematical and computational tools to make informed decisions based on data. Key topics include probability theory, statistical inference, regression analysis, experimental design, and data visualization. Students also learn how to apply statistical methods to real-world problems in fields like economics, health, business, science, and social research. Graduates can pursue careers as statisticians, data analysts, researchers, or actuaries in government, industry, healthcare, finance, and academia.
